Hubbard Street Dance Chicago, one of America’s favorite contemporary companies, celebrates their 36th year with a Minneapolis program including Casi-Casa by famed Swedish master choreographer Mats Ek (whose Swan Lake had Minnesota audiences raving when the Cullberg Ballet performed it here in 2002). Known for its innovative repertoire, Hubbard Street was the first American company to stage this physically and theatrically inventive piece. Casi-Casa fuses jazz and bagpipes with electronic music and rock. Elements of an everyday life are distorted in a surreal landscape that literally tilts, where household items like vacuums occasionally become dance partners. The program also includes two pieces by resident company choreographer Alejandro Cerrudo: Little Mortal Jump, a black-and-white themed piece tailor made to showcase the company’s talent, and PACOPEPEPLUTO, a series of three exquisite solos strung together by their vivacious physicality. Finally, the repertoire features the world premiere of Fluence from Robyn Mineko Williams, featuring five men and four women who appear profoundly vulnerable one moment, yet in the next like neutral avatars being remotely controlled. Quick double-takes and stuttering movements suggest the entire piece itself is fighting internal glitches, disintegration, or a faulty internet connection.
